Boscobel : Or, The History of his Sacred Majesties most Miraculous Preservation After the Battle of Worcester, 3. Sept. 1651

In "Boscobel," Thomas Blount intricately weaves a narrative set against the backdrop of the English Civil War, deftly blending historical detail with a vivid literary style that invites readers into the turbulence of 17th-century England. The prose is notable for its elegant and lyrical quality, drawing upon Renaissance influences while presenting a raw perspective on loyalty, betrayal, and survival. Blount's portrayal of the royalist figure, Charles II, showcases a blend of history and imagination, offering insight into a pivotal moment in English history through richly drawn characters and evocative settings. Thomas Blount was not only a notable author but also a scholar, whose curious mind and experiences during a time of great political upheaval likely inspired his writing. His background in linguistics and his deep understanding of contemporary issues lend depth to his characterizations and themes. Living through a time of shifting loyalties and societal challenges, Blount infused "Boscobel" with a sense of urgency and relevance, reflecting both historical realities and personal convictions.
